    Tombs. They are the most significant feature of The Sims 3: World Adventures, but are very difficult and time-consuming to make. In this special part-written/part-video tutorial, we’ll show you how to create tombs with ease. Our aforementioned video is available below and takes one through all the main tomb building items such as traps, keystones, floor switches and hole-in-the-walls, and shows how to set states and setup triggers.

    World Adventures brings the new feature of tombs and with that comes surprise! When a sim enters a tomb, they won’t know what’s around the corner or through the next door. Traps? Treasure? Mummies?

    Remember: to access the debug items use the cheats testingcheatsenabled true and buyDebug. Then, to access the debug options on items, Ctrl+Shift+Click instead of just clicking.
